Here is where car loan interest rates in 2026 actually stand across major lenders in India.
Current Car Loan Interest Rate 2026 — What Banks Are Offering
As of May 2026, here is a quick snapshot of new car loan rates from lenders active in Tamil Nadu:
- SBI: 8.75% – 9.65% p.a. (linked to repo rate; best rate for government employees)
- HDFC Bank: 9.00% – 11.50% p.a. (varies by CIBIL score and loan-to-value ratio)
- ICICI Bank: 9.10% – 11.75% p.a. (pre-approved customers get lower rates)
- Axis Bank: 9.25% – 12.00% p.a.
- Kotak Mahindra Prime: 9.50% – 13.00% p.a. (higher for used cars)
These are not the rates printed on the showroom poster. The rate you actually get depends on your credit profile, income, employer category, and whether you negotiate. The Reserve Bank of India kept the repo rate unchanged at 6.00% in its April 2026 policy review, which means floating rate loans are relatively stable right now — a reasonable time to lock in.
What Affects the Rate You Get Personally
This is where most applicants make a mistake. They assume the bank will offer them the same rate advertised on a billboard. That rarely happens unless your CIBIL score is above 750 and your debt-to-income ratio is clean.
Here's what most applicants miss: lenders in 2026 are increasingly using bureau data beyond just CIBIL — Experian and CRIF scores are also being checked. A score of 720 might get you through the door, but 760+ is where you access the best pricing tier.
Other factors that influence your rate: salaried vs self-employed, loan tenure (shorter tenure = lower risk = sometimes lower rate), vehicle model and age (new vs pre-owned), and whether the dealership has a co-lending tie-up with the bank. Used Car Loans — A Different Story Entirely
If you are buying a pre-owned vehicle, expect rates to start at 11% and go up to 17% depending on the vehicle age and lender. Most banks cap the loan at 80% of the assessed value, not the purchase price. HDFC and Kotak are the most active lenders in the used car space in Tamil Nadu, but their risk pricing is aggressive.

How to Reduce Your Car Loan EMI in 2026
Three practical moves: First, improve your CIBIL score before applying — even 30 days of disciplined credit card usage and zero missed EMIs can move your score by 15-20 points. A 30% down payment instead of 20% reduces your principal and signals lower risk to the lender. Third, avoid applying to multiple banks simultaneously — each hard inquiry drops your score by 3-8 points.

What is the lowest car loan interest rate available in India in 2026?
SBI currently offers the lowest starting rate at 8.75% p.a. for new cars, available primarily to salaried applicants with a CIBIL score above 750 and government or PSU employment. Private sector employees with strong profiles can access 9.00% to 9.25% from HDFC or ICICI.
Does my CIBIL score affect my car loan rate?
Yes, significantly. Most banks have a tiered pricing model — a score above 760 can get you 0.50% to 1.25% lower than someone with a score of 700. On a ₹7 lakh loan over 5 years, that difference adds up to ₹20,000 or more in total interest paid.
